Bol A woman's journey through heartbreak and faith leads to profound personal transformation. As she confronts her past and embraces healing, she discovers strength, resilience, and a renewed sense of purpose, revealing beauty born from life's challenges.In From the Ashes Came the Rose, Julie's life appears stable, yet beneath the surface lies a tumult of emotional wounds and unresolved pain. As her world begins to unravel through painful realizations and strained relationships, she is thrust into a season of loss and uncertainty. This unexpected journey forces her to confront not only her current struggles but also the weight of her past. Old fears and patterns resurface, demanding her attention and reflection.What starts as a period of deep grief evolves into a transformative process. Through raw honesty and spiritual wrestling, Julie learns that her breaking may also signify the beginning of healing. Themes of faith, identity, and forgiveness intertwine as she grapples with trusting God amidst the unknown. Relationships are tested, priorities shift, and she gradually gains a deeper understanding of grace and self-worth.The heart of Julie's story lies in her transformation. Rather than offering quick fixes, the narrative traces her believable journey from mere survival to renewal. She discovers that growth often requires navigating through fire, that healing is rarely straightforward, and that true strength is often found in the quietest moments.By the end, Julie emerges not as a woman with a perfect life, but as someone profoundly changed. The rose symbolizes her journey-beauty born from ashes, reflecting the refinement that comes from struggle. From the Ashes Came the Rose ultimately conveys a message of hope, illustrating how even the most painful seasons can cultivate new life and unexpected beauty.
